Output 3c9935245dd5ad0f26b2d3e3d5b96df1fecf53645c55861c75f384f4bbde966d:5

value
63749109
script pubkey
OP_0 OP_PUSHBYTES_32 b18d86f8648b40082d60533bd895f3657986cfbb32e4ff12ccf1f56151ac66e9
address
bc1qkxxcd7ry3dqqsttq2vaa390nv4ucdnamxtj07ykv786kz5dvvm5s25r45w
transaction
3c9935245dd5ad0f26b2d3e3d5b96df1fecf53645c55861c75f384f4bbde966d
spent
true